What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Galt, Iowa?

The average monthly cost for assisted living in Galt, Iowa, typically ranges from $3,500 to $5,000, depending on the level of care required, room type, and specific amenities offered by the facility. This is generally lower than the Iowa state average, making Galt an affordable option for senior care in the region.

Are there any assisted living facilities located directly in Galt, Iowa?

Galt is a very small community, and there may not be a dedicated assisted living facility within the city limits. However, residents often access facilities in nearby towns such as Clarion, Eagle Grove, or Webster City, which are within a short driving distance and offer a range of senior living options for Galt-area families.

What types of services and amenities can be expected in assisted living near Galt, Iowa?

Assisted living facilities serving Galt, Iowa, typically provide services such as medication management, ass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s), housekeeping, meals, and social activities. Many also offer transportation for local appointments and outings, taking advantage of the quiet, rural setting while ensuring access to necessary medical and community resources in Wright County.

How are assisted living facilities regulated in Iowa, and what should families in Galt look for?

Assisted living facilities in Iowa are regulated by the Iowa Department of Inspections, Appeals, and Licensing (DIAL). Families in Galt should ensure any facility they consider is licensed and has a clean record of inspections. It's also important to review the facility's service agreement and understand Iowa’s specific regulations regarding resident rights, staffing, and safety protocols.

What local resources are available to seniors and their families in Galt, Iowa, when considering assisted living?

Seniors and families in Galt can contact the North Central Iowa Area Agency on Aging (NCIA3) for guidance on assisted living options, financial assistance programs, and caregiver support. Additionally, local organizations such as the Galt Community Center or Wright County Public Health may offer resources, referrals, and support services to help navigate senior care decisions in the area.

Exploring Long-Term Care Options in Galt, Iowa

When a loved one in Galt needs more support than can be provided at home, families often begin exploring long-term care facilities. This journey can feel overwhelming, but understanding what these facilities offer and how to find the right fit can bring peace of mind. In essence, a long-term care facility provides 24-hour skilled nursing care, personal assistance, and medical supervision for individuals with chronic health conditions or significant needs. It’s a different level of care than assisted living, designed for those who require consistent, hands-on support from licensed nurses and aides.

For families in our close-knit Galt community, the decision often involves considering both local options and facilities in nearby towns like Algona or Humboldt. It’s important to visit in person, and not just once. Try to visit at different times of the day—during a meal, on a weekend, or in the evening—to get a true sense of the daily rhythm and staff interactions. Pay close attention to the residents. Do they seem engaged and content? Is the environment clean and welcoming? Don’t hesitate to ask about staff turnover rates; consistency in caregivers is crucial for building trust and providing quality care, something deeply valued in our Iowa towns.

One practical tip is to look beyond the building itself and inquire about the facility’s connection to the local community. In a small town, these connections are vital. Does the facility arrange for local groups to visit? Are residents able to participate in community events when possible? This helps maintain a sense of identity and belonging, which is so important for well-being. Also, consider the practicalities of Iowa’s climate. When winter weather makes travel challenging, having family nearby for regular visits becomes a significant factor. Choosing a facility within a manageable driving distance from Galt, even if it’s in a neighboring county, can make all the difference in maintaining those crucial family connections during snowy months.

Financing long-term care is a major concern for most families. It’s essential to have candid conversations with facility administrators about costs, what is included, and what payment methods they accept, such as Medicaid, long-term care insurance, or private pay. In Iowa, Medicaid waiver programs can sometimes help with costs, but eligibility and facility participation vary. Seeking guidance from a local elder law attorney or a senior resource center can provide clarity on these complex financial matters.

Ultimately, selecting a long-term care facility is about finding a place where your loved one will be safe, treated with dignity, and given the medical and personal care they require. Trust your instincts during visits. The right place will feel like a caring community, not just an institution. It should be a place where staff members know residents by name and where you can envision your family member living with comfort and respect. This decision is a profound act of love, ensuring your loved one receives the compassionate support they need in this next chapter of life.
